Expected Mileage


On average, a well-maintained 1994 Ford Ranger XLT can achieve approximately 18 to 24 miles per gallon (MPG) depending on whether it is driven in the city or on the highway. Here’s a breakdown:



  • City Driving: Expect around 18 MPG.

  • Highway Driving: Expect around 24 MPG.


These figures can vary based on the factors mentioned earlier, but they provide a general guideline for potential mileage.

How many miles does a 1994 Ford Ranger last?


Depends on which powertrain. The highest mileage 4.0 I've personally seen was 240k. The 2.3 I've seen with 400k.

What is the gas mileage on a 1994 Ford Ranger 4.0 V6?


Based on data from 129 vehicles, 5,438 fuel-ups and 1,420,342 miles of driving, the 1994 Ford Ranger gets a combined Avg MPG of 19.39 with a 0.14 MPG margin of error.

How many miles do Ford Rangers usually last?


250-300,000 miles
When properly maintained, Ranger engines can typically last up to 250-300,000 miles, which is comparable to competitors like the Toyota Tacoma, Nissan Frontier, and Chevy Colorado. Engines such as the 4.0L V6 have proven to be particularly durable, with some units reaching over 300,000 miles.



How reliable are 1994 Ford Rangers?


As a whole, consumers found the vehicle's reliability and quality to be its strongest features and comfort to be its weakest. 397 out of 685 of owners (58% of them) rank the 1994 Ranger five out of five stars. Overall, consumers seem aligned in their opinions of the 1994 Ford Ranger.
